what are 2 factors of 3 that add up to 6​

Respuesta :

rtankus
rtankus rtankus
  • 17-10-2019

Answer:

None.

Step-by-step explanation:

There are only 2 factors of 3 since 3 is s prime number. the factors are 1 and 3. Summed together they equal 4.
